The importance of compassionate responses to child sexual abuse-related trauma

In this conversation, Dr Joe Tucci, National Centre Board Chair and CEO of the Australian Childhood Foundation, and Dr Paul Gilbert, President of the Compassionate Mind Foundation UK, explore what compassion is and the role it plays in responding to and supporting people who have experienced child sexual abuse-related trauma to recover and heal.

We unpack the meaning of and science behind compassion and explore what a compassionate community looks like. There are discussions about how compassion is used in therapeutic responses and practical suggestions that everyone can apply to create a more compassionate community.
